Seneca Foods is one of North America's leading providers of packaged fruits and vegetables with facilities located throughout the United States.  Our high quality products are primarily sourced from over 2,000 American farms. Seneca holds the largest share of the retail private label, food service, and export canned vegetable markets, distributing to over 90 countries. Products are also sold under the brands of Libby’s®, Aunt Nellie’s®, READ®, Seneca Farms®, Green Valley®, CherryMan®, Paradise®, Pennant®, and Seneca labels, including Seneca snack chips. Seneca also provides vegetable products to other companies under various co-pack arrangements.

Seneca Foods Corporation of Montgomery, a food production and distribution center located approximately 35 miles southwest of the Twin Cities metro, is currently seeking an Agricultural Intern to join its team for the 2026 summer production season. 

This internship is geared toward current/recent undergraduate students and will provide hands-on industry experience working with the Agriculture Department during the busy production season. Internships typically run from late May through August but are flexible with school schedules.

Responsibilities:

- Exposure to crop management, weed control, and record keeping.
- Procurement of raw product from a grower base to meet plant production goals.
- Look for opportunities to reduce costs and enhance overall operations. Study procedures and make recommendations for improvement.
- Assist Field Representative with day-to-day management of field operations.
- Communicate with land owners, growers, equipment dealers, and material suppliers.
-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ications:
- Good attention to detail and accuracy.
- Willingness and ability to function in a team environment.
- Strong communication skills.
- Current or recent undergraduate student status.
- Majors in Ag Business, Farm Management, or a related field are preferred.

Staring wage range based on skills, abilities, and experience at $18.00 per hour.
